Cords Madeira Mountain Trail was nearly 7 of the best miles I’ve experienced in California. Stunning views the entire trail. Pinnacle views are breathtaking. I was fortunate enough to hike on a clear day, and could not have had a better experience. The trail offers diverse environments, rocky terrain that turns to into a pine Forrest! The trail towards the end is single file with 360 views.

I can not recommend this more.

The hike was a little bit more difficult than I expected.

In my experience the most challenging part was getting to the trailhead. you have to specify in your GPS that you want Corte Madera Trailhead. Which will have you exit Buckman Springs Road off the 8. Take you through some streets to a metal gate with a heart. To the left is the small parking area maybe 8 cars fit there. Start past the metal gate and walk through the shaded area with trees. The enviroment changes a lot throughout the trail. You start any very shaded area then you head up into an area with high bushes then some dirt and then you're almost in a desert type atmosphere and then you end up around pine trees. there are many "lookout" spots through the trail. Once you pass the pine tree area and some large boulders the trail becomes small and almost non existent. Once you get to the top you have to look around a little bit for the box and sign.

The hike is beautiful and worth the time. Although this was difficult I am definitely coming back. My 20 lbs Boston Terrier made it.

Beautiful views at the top. Did with my dog, who is very experienced in hiking with me. However I wouldn't recommend doing with a dog since much of trail is single-track and very narrow and winding. Took us about 3 hours round-trip.
